Tart cherries, sweet dreams

Noticeably more acidic than sweet cherries, tart cherries consist of perhaps the most crucial element for getting a good night’s sleep: Melatonin.

A hormone that is produced in the pineal gland in the brand, melatonin helps to regulate the circadian rhythm , or your body’s sleep-wake system, helping to promote sleepiness.
